What is Kilowatt-hour to Joule Conversion?
Kilowatt-hour (kWh) and joule (J) are both units used to measure energy, but they serve different purposes depending on the scale of the measurement. If you ever need to convert kilowatt-hour to joule, knowing the exact conversion formula is essential.
KWh to j Conversion Formula:
One Kilowatt-hour is equal to 3600000 Joule.
Formula: 1 kWh = 3600000 J
By using this conversion factor, you can easily convert any energy from kilowatt-hour to joule with precision.
Convert 1 Kilowatt-hour to Joule
To convert 1 kilowatt-hour to joule, multiply the value by 3600000 since:
1 kilowatt-hour = 3600000 joule
So:
1 × 3600000 = 3600000
Result: 1 kilowatt-hour = 3600000 joule
